Benchmark™ Alkalinity Test Kit is a simple titration-style test kit for measuring alkalinity in reef aquariums. It is designed to give a clear, repeatable dKH result so you can understand your reef’s carbonate hardness before making dosing adjustments.

What It Measures

This kit measures aquarium alkalinity in dKH. Alkalinity is one of the most important reef water parameters for maintaining stable coral growth, calcium carbonate formation, and overall chemistry balance.

Test Procedure

  1. Rinse the test vial with aquarium water.
  2. Add 5.00 mL of aquarium water to the vial.
  3. Add 1 drop of indicator.
  4. Swirl gently. The sample should turn blue.
  5. Fill the syringe with alkalinity titrant to 1.00 mL.
  6. Add titrant slowly while swirling.
  7. Stop at the first stable colour change from blue to red.
  8. Record how many mL of titrant were used.
  9. Calculate the result using the formula below.

Calculation

Alkalinity dKH = mL titrant used × 10

Example

If you used 0.80 mL of titrant:

0.80 × 10 = 8.0 dKH

Recommended Reef Range

Typical reef aquariums are often maintained around 7.0–9.5 dKH, depending on the system, coral demand, salt mix, and husbandry approach.

Tips for Best Accuracy

  • Read the syringe at eye level.
  • Swirl continuously as you approach the endpoint.
  • Add titrant slowly near the colour change.
  • Run a second test if the endpoint was difficult to judge.
  • Rinse the vial and syringe with fresh water after testing.
